Correlation of Mechanical Thresholds, Glasgow Composite Measure Pain Scale, and Sharp and Wheeler Grading Scale in Dogs with Acute Thoracolumbar Disc Extrusions.

Abstract

In dogs with intervertebral disc extrusion (IVDE), the Glasgow Composite Measure Pain Scale-Short Form (GCMPS) and the Sharp and Wheeler Grading Scale (SWGS) are routinely used in the evaluation of pain (GCMPS) and neurological function (SWGS). Additionally, quantitative sensory tests (QSTs) are increasingly being incorporated into veterinary clinical practice for pain characterisation. The aim was to investigate a possible relationship between the GCMPS, the SWGS, and mechanical thresholds (MTs) in 31 client-owned dogs with thoracolumbar IVDEs. Dogs were always assessed in the same order, starting with pain rating using the GCMPS, followed by classifying neurological severity using the SWGS, before determining MTs using a handheld pressure algometer. Dogs were evaluated over a five-day testing period (before surgery and on days one, two, three, and ten after surgery). The GCMPS and the SWGS data remained consistent across all days of testing. No statistically significant correlation or difference was observed between the scores. MTs showed a significant negative correlation with the GCMPS (r = -0.311; < 0.001) and a positive one with the SWGS (r = 0.282; = 0.002). The GCMPS and MTs showed a slight divergence in their progression. MTs might be more sensitive than GCMPS in reflecting clinical improvement and should be considered for clinical practice.

在患有椎间盘突出症(IVDE)的犬类中,格拉斯哥综合疼痛量表简表(GCMPS)和夏普与惠勒分级量表(SWGS)通常用于评估疼痛(GCMPS)和神经功能(SWGS)。此外,定量感觉测试(QSTs)越来越多地被纳入兽医临床实践以进行疼痛特征描述。目的是研究31只患胸腰椎IVDEs的家养犬中GCMPS、SWGS和机械阈值(MTs)之间可能存在的关系。犬类总是按照相同顺序进行评估,首先使用GCMPS进行疼痛评分,接着使用SWGS对神经严重程度进行分级,然后使用手持式压力痛觉计确定MTs。在为期五天的测试期内(手术前以及手术后第1、2、3和10天)对犬类进行评估。GCMPS和SWGS数据在所有测试日都保持一致。在分数之间未观察到统计学上的显著相关性或差异。MTs与GCMPS呈显著负相关(r = -0.311;<0.001),与SWGS呈正相关(r = 0.282;= 0.002)。GCMPS和MTs在进展上显示出轻微差异。MTs在反映临床改善方面可能比GCMPS更敏感,应在临床实践中予以考虑。
